Job description

Ryder’s shop operations run on trust, and the Customer Service Coordinator is the person who earns it every day. You’ll be the connective tissue between customers, technicians, and the rental counter, keeping vehicles moving, communications clear, and parts on the shelf. If you’re organized, personable, and energized by a fast‑paced environment where no two days look alike, this role puts you at the center of the action.

WHAT YOU’LL DO
Keep Customers in the Loop
  • Be the friendly, reliable voice customers count on for scheduling, status updates, and issue resolution.
  • Own communication protocols for preventive maintenance, breakdowns, and repair follow‑up, so customers always know where things stand.
  • Help drive Customer Satisfaction (CSI) scores through consistent, high‑quality service.
Keep the Shop Running Smoothly
  • Build and update the work planning sheet, creating repair order tasks that keep technicians productive.
  • Review maintenance reports to proactively schedule PM, repair campaigns, and follow‑up work.
  • Partner with the rental counter on repair needs, substitute units, and vehicle wash turnaround.
  • Coordinate outside repairs with vendors and customers, freeing up the management team to focus on shop operations.
Keep Parts Flowing
  • Manage the full parts cycle: physical inventory, ordering, receiving, stocking, purchase orders, and invoicing.
  • Recommend min‑max inventory levels and help manage parts obsolescence.
  • Process warranty and return shipments, and keep the parts room organized and shop‑ready.
Keep the Details Covered
  • Handle incoming shop calls with professionalism and a solutions mindset.
  • Maintain vehicle maintenance files and shop clerical records.
  • Process accounts payable and create repair orders for technicians.
  • Take on other projects as they come up — variety is part of the job.
